Next time you have the sluggish problem, drive it a mile then stop and go check your rear brakes to see if they are warm... if they are then your e-brake is probably dragging, if not then there is another good possibility.
You say it only does this on really cold mornings; chances are good what you're experiencing is just the effects of temperature on your tranny and rear end oil along with the grease in your bearings... once they warm up from a little driving they thin out and things loosen up again.
